These include verbal, non-verbal, written and visual communication: 1. Verbal … crystal and jocelyn potter marriedWebCommunication is a two-way process. As a carer of someone with dementia, you will probably have to learn to listen more carefully. You may need to be more aware of non-verbal messages, such as facial expressions and body language.
